ALEXANDRIA, Va., Aug. 20 -- United States Patent no. 12,394,361, issued on Aug. 19, was assigned to X Display Co. Technology Ltd. (Dublin).
"Multiplexed column drivers for passive-matrix control" was invented by Murat Ozbas (Penfield, N.Y.), Imre Knausz (Fairport, N.Y.) and Ronald S. Cok (Rochester, N.Y.).
According to the abstract* released by the U.S. Patent & Trademark Office: "A passive-matrix controller provides a control signal to each column of multiple columns of components, a driver for each column wire, and a multiplexer. Each column of components is connected to a column wire.
